3 Tips for Choosing the Right College

April 23, 2020 by Sam H.

3 Tips for Choosing the Right CollegeThere are approximately 5,300 colleges and universities in the United States, which can make choosing the best college a challenge. The college you attend, you will play a significant role in your academic success and overall college experience, which is why the decision should not be taken lightly. 1. Start researching colleges early

With so many colleges to choose from, you must start researching as soon as possible. Ideally, you should start the college search during the start of your junior year. By the start of your senior year, you should narrow down your list to your top college choices. There is a massive variety of factors to consider when researching potential colleges. This includes location, size, academics, rankings, and social activities. You also need to consider the cost as tuition fees vary between different schools. However, you shouldn’t let cost put you off applying for a college you love. 2. Rank your priorities

Take your time to consider your preferences and weigh up the pros and cons of each college that you are interested in. For instance, a top priority should be that the college offers the academic major of your choice. Whereas a lower priority may be that the college provides extracurricular activities that you’re interested in, such as sports clubs. Overall, you need to aim to narrow down your options and choose a college that is an excellent academic and social fit for you. You can use an online college finder tool to help you find the best colleges based on your preferences.

3. Visit college campuses

You should always try to visit any college campuses that you are interested in. This will allow you to get a proper feel for the campus and decide whether you would like to spend the next four years of your life there. You may find that you don’t like the atmosphere at a campus that seemed perfect on paper. Whereas you may fall in love with a campus that you weren’t that keen on from your research. Therefore, it is so important to visit college campuses before deciding on your top choices. You should contact the college application office to arrange a campus visit. According to experts at The Princeton Review, you can get the most out of your college visits by scheduling your visit during term time, talking to current students, and taking the official campus tour as well as exploring by yourself.

Summary

Choosing a college is a critical decision that will have a significant impact on your college experience and future life. Make sure that you think carefully about what you want from your college experience and look for a college that will suit your wants and needs. Use the above tips to assist you in your college search and help you find your dream campus.
